Overview REPA is Europe's leading distributor of spare parts for foodservice and refrigeration equipment, coffee and vending machines, and a trusted partner to OEMs, delivering the right part at the right time. With the world's largest inventory of in-stock original and universal spare parts, consumables and accessories, and a network of automated fulfillment centers across Europe and beyond, REPA ensures fast delivery times. AI-powered tools, 360° images, detailed exploded views, technical manuals and other search features on its eCommerce platform and mobile app help customers identify and order parts. A team of experts speaking more than 20 languages helps customers find solutions for every repair. REPA is the European division of Parts Town Unlimited. Key Responsibilities Design and maintain scalable, secure architectures for cross-stream business processes. Lead integration of legacy ERP systems (Navision, SAGE X3), future enterprise ERP systems, SAP Commerce Cloud, WMS, and web shops for seamless data flow and process automation. Collaborate with business stakeholders to align technical solutions with business objectives and improve process efficiency. Define API, middleware, and integration strategies, ensuring data integrity and security across platforms. Provide technical leadership and guidance to internal teams and external partners. Oversee solution delivery, ensuring architectural compliance and timely execution. Evaluate emerging technologies to enhance O2C and P2P processes, including cloud scalability strategies. Produce and maintain technical documentation and architecture artefacts. Mentor team members and promote knowledge sharing. Qualifications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field. 9 years of solution architecture experience, particularly in ERP, e-commerce, and logistics integrations. Strong expertise with SAP Commerce Cloud, enterprise ERP, WMS platforms, and multiple system integrations. Proven skills in API design, microservices architecture, and middleware platforms like Dell Boomi or MuleSoft. Solid understanding of data flows, ETL, and security best practices. Excellent analytical, communication, and interpersonal skills. Willingness to travel within Europe as needed. Cloud platform experience (Azure preferred) and DevOps knowledge are advantages. Familiarity with Agile methodologies and project management tools. Relevant certifications such as TOGAF, SAP Commerce Cloud, or ERP-specific credentials are a plus.
